- This paper introduces a novel approach to building virtual laboratories of embedded control systems using TrueTime and Easy Java Simulations. TrueTime is a freeware MATLAB/Simulink based tool commonly used to simulate embedded control systems. Easy Java Simulations is a popular authoring tool that facilitates the creation of pedagogical simulations. According to the proposed approach, authors use TrueTime to develop the simulation of an embedded control system and then move to Easy Java Simulations to link the system to a sophisticated graphical user interface that provides the visualization and user interaction of the virtual lab required for pedagogical purposes. The combination of these two tools conforms a powerful, yet simple, approach to the creation of effective pedagogic simulation of real-time control systems. (Less)
